Vegan Cinnamon Sugar Cookies

Party guests who follow a vegan diet tend to get stuck with a bowlful of celery sticks while everyone else dines on delicious dishes. This year, earn a reputation as a truly awesome host by preparing these vegan cinnamon sugar cookies. Made with olive oil instead of butter, they're light, sweet and crunchy. Make enough for your non-vegan friends, too, because everyone will want to try these crowd pleasers.

Cast Iron Skillet Recipe: Cinnamon Rolls

Maybe your party guests are traditionalists who know what they like and like what they know. For those guests, a batch of classic cinnamon rolls is a foolproof choice. This cinnamon roll recipe is made in a cast iron skillet, giving the rolls a wonderfully crunchy crust. Serve them at a brunch gathering, or frankly, at any time of day.
